NATIONAL SUNGLASSES DAY National Sunglasses Day is celebrated each year on June 27. Celebrate this day with summer’s most popular fashion accessory. Sunglasses help to protect your eyes from harmful UV light. Healthcare professionals around the country recommend eye protection whenever the sun comes out to protect your eyes from ultraviolet radiation (UV) and blue light, which can cause several different serious eye problems. Sunglasses became a fashion accessory in the 1940′s. Way back in prehistoric and historic time, Inuit peoples wore flattened walrus ivory “glasses”. They would look through the narrow slits to block out harmful reflected rays from the sun. Sunglasses started to become more popularly widespread in the early 1900′s, especially among movie stars. In 1929, Sam Foster introduced inexpensive mass-produced sunglasses to America. He began selling them under the name Foster Grant from a Woolworth Store on the Boardwalk in Atlantic City, New Jersey. Discovered by Edwin H. Land in 1936, polarized sunglasses became available.
